Job Description

Position Summary

The University of Denver Sturm College of Law seeks applications from full-time members of its faculty to serve as the inaugural Director of the Native American Rights Project which focuses on advancing research teaching and external engagement in the area of Native American rights.

The position is contemplated as a three-year appointment commencing in August 2025.

Essential Functions

The Director will undertake the following principal responsibilities:

  • Lead and manage the Native American Rights Project in a manner designed to enhance its visibility stature and impact;
  • Support an appropriate slate of programmatic activities including lectures workshops and other events;
  • Provide recommendations regarding curricular enhancements in the area of Native American rights;
  • Advise students on professional opportunities in the field of tribal law federal Indian law and Native American rights;
  • Collaborate with the Dean to develop and lead an external advisory board composed of influential experts in the field; and
  • Work closely with the Dean and the law schools Executive Director of Development to secure additional resources for the Project from individuals and organizations.

Required Qualifications

  • Full-time faculty member at the Sturm College of Law
  • J.D. and/or Ph.D. degrees (or their equivalents)
  • Expertise in the field of Native American rights
